Get Ready for School Holiday Fun in the Southern Grampians!
With the school holidays just around the corner, Southern Grampians Shire Council is excited to announce another stellar lineup of activities to keep all the kids entertained, inspired, and engaged.
From creative crafts to mesmerising movies, there’s something to cure all the boredom.
Southern Grampians Shire Council Acting Mayor Afton Barber said these activities offer a mix of free and low-cost options to ensure every family can join in the fun.
“With a diverse range of activities council aims to create fun for all ages, from young children through to teenagers these school holidays,” said Cr Barber.
Gather your kids and their friends and join us for a fun-filled program. Here’s a sneak peak of the must-attend events.
Saturday 29 March – Josephine wants to Dance
Get the kids in the holiday spirit with a pre-school holiday performance of Josephine. She's bold. She's bouncy. She's back! A hilarious musical about self-discovery, ballet, hip-hop and...a kangaroo.
Wednesday, 9 April – Moviecraft: "Dogman"
Get creative in making a mini Dogman theatre followed by the entertaining movie experience that’s perfect for young film enthusiasts.
Thursday, 10 April – Anime Drawing Workshop
Let their imaginations soar as they learn to create amazing art in this step-by-step anime workshop.
Saturday, 12 April – Shadow Puppets: Asia Raya
Discover the enchanting world of shadow puppetry in this culturally rich and engaging session bringing traditional folk story to life. There will even be a chance for the kids to participate in interactive dance.
Monday, 14 April – Create and Decorate Your Own Bunny Mirror
A fun Easter themed session to unleash the kids creativity with this hands-on craft session that’s as fun as it is memorable.
Wednesday, 16 April – Moviecraft: "Minecraft"
For the older kids - Join the adventure with this thrilling and imaginative film inspired by the popular game, immerse yourself in 3D paper making of character Steve.
Thursday, 17 April – "The Animals of the Magical Mountain"
Come on a journey full of singing, dancing and adventure with Wozza from Australia and his animal friends.
